Two things have made treacle sought after in the U.S.: The fact that treacle tart is the favorite dessert of Harry Potter (it's mentioned in several books in the series) and the popularity of The Great British Baking Show (like Harry, Mary Berry calls treacle tart a favorite—absolutely scrummy, in fact). It is prepared using shortcrust pastry, with a thick filling made of golden syrup (also known as light treacle ), breadcrumbs, and lemon juice or zest. Mary Berry's recipe calls for a 400*F oven for the first 10 minutes, check for browning and top with aluminum foil if needed, then continue to bake the tart for another 25-30 minutes at 350*F - or until golden brown on top with a set-filling.
